From aa7840088975c5f299561cb3966b50409e5a5e0f Mon Sep 17 00:00:00 2001 From: wangmenglan Date: Fri, 5 Jul 2024 11:56:51 +0800 Subject: [PATCH] TSG-21715 update Clixon to 1.2.41 --- ansible/install_config/group_vars/rpm_version.yml | 2 +- .../files/script/build_clixon_default_db.sh | 8 ++++++++ .../roles/tsg-os-HAL/files/script/tsg-os-HAL.sh | 14 -------------- 3 files changed, 9 insertions(+), 15 deletions(-) diff --git a/ansible/install_config/group_vars/rpm_version.yml b/ansible/install_config/group_vars/rpm_version.yml index 707a7506..3c9e5d2f 100644 --- a/ansible/install_config/group_vars/rpm_version.yml +++ b/ansible/install_config/group_vars/rpm_version.yml @@ -91,7 +91,7 @@ hasp_tools_rpm_version: tsg_os_clixon_rpm_version: cligen: cligen-5.8.0-release clixon: clixon-5.8.3-89803bb - tsg-os-mgnt-srv: tsg-os-mgnt-srv-1.2.40.56ffe6b + tsg-os-mgnt-srv: tsg-os-mgnt-srv-1.2.41.5b3e8d1 sce_rpm_version: sce: sce-1.3.2.a0f1eca diff --git a/ansible/roles/tsg-os-HAL/files/script/build_clixon_default_db.sh b/ansible/roles/tsg-os-HAL/files/script/build_clixon_default_db.sh index cc05f7cd..69573184 100644 --- a/ansible/roles/tsg-os-HAL/files/script/build_clixon_default_db.sh +++ b/ansible/roles/tsg-os-HAL/files/script/build_clixon_default_db.sh @@ -9,6 +9,14 @@ build_default_db() ${IOCORE} ${WORKLOAD_CORE} + + ${MRZCPD_SZ_DATA} + ${MRZCPD_SZ_TUNNEL} + ${MRZCPD_CREATE_MODE} + ${MRZCPD_DIRECT_PKTMBUF} + ${MRZCPD_CHECK_BUFFER_LEAK} + ${MRZCPD_POLL_WAIT_THROTTLE} + " echo ${resources} | xmlstarlet fo > ${tsg_clixon_default_db_file} diff --git a/ansible/roles/tsg-os-HAL/files/script/tsg-os-HAL.sh b/ansible/roles/tsg-os-HAL/files/script/tsg-os-HAL.sh index 148f9a05..66f57706 100644 --- a/ansible/roles/tsg-os-HAL/files/script/tsg-os-HAL.sh +++ b/ansible/roles/tsg-os-HAL/files/script/tsg-os-HAL.sh @@ -5,7 +5,6 @@ set -x tsg_os_HAL_cfg_file="/etc/sysconfig/tsg-os-HAL.conf" tsg_clixon_cfg_file="/opt/tsg/clixon/etc/mgnt-srv.conf" -mrzcpd_conf_file="/var/run/share/container_mrzcpd.conf" cpu_partitioning_conf_file='/etc/tuned/cpu-partitioning-variables.conf' tsg_clixon_default_db_file='/etc/clixon/default_db' @@ -81,17 +80,6 @@ set_clixon_configuration() [ -f ${tsg_clixon_cfg_file} ] && sed -i "s/^nf_count=.*$/nf_count=${NF_COUNT}/g" ${tsg_clixon_cfg_file} } -set_mrzcpd_configuration() -{ - echo "sz_indirect_pktmbuf=${MRZCPD_INDIRECT_PKTMBUF}" > ${mrzcpd_conf_file} - echo "sz_direct_pktmbuf=${MRZCPD_DIRECT_PKTMBUF}" >> ${mrzcpd_conf_file} - echo "poll_wait_throttle=${MRZCPD_POLL_WAIT_THROTTLE}" >> ${mrzcpd_conf_file} - echo "sz_data=${MRZCPD_SZ_DATA}" >> ${mrzcpd_conf_file} - echo "sz_tunnel=${MRZCPD_SZ_TUNNEL}" >> ${mrzcpd_conf_file} - echo "check_buffer_leak=${MRZCPD_CHECK_BUFFER_LEAK}" >> ${mrzcpd_conf_file} - echo "create_mode=${MRZCPD_CREATE_MODE}" >> ${mrzcpd_conf_file} -} - calculate_hugepages() { if [ ! -n "$HUGEPAGES" ]; then @@ -290,9 +278,7 @@ calculate_mrzcpd_indirect_pktmbuf calculate_mrzcpd_sz_tunnel calculate_mrzcpd_direct_pktmbuf -set_k3s_configuration ${mem_num} set_clixon_configuration -set_mrzcpd_configuration # add sn to k8s node annotations. read_device_type